Gun safes present a unique moving challenge, combining weight, shape, and security considerations into one heavy-duty task. In a town like Foxborough—known for its charming neighborhoods, seasonal weather swings, and not-so-forgiving driveways—attempting to move a gun safe without the right tools or knowledge is a recipe for damage or injury. That's why having experienced movers on your side isn’t a luxury—it’s a necessity.

Here’s what you need to know before your gun safe ever leaves the house.

First, consider the physical characteristics. Gun safes can weigh hundreds of pounds and often have a high center of gravity. One wrong tilt or uneven step, and it could slide, tip, or worse. Movers must account for staircases, door frames, floor types, and driveway inclines—all of which Foxborough homes can vary in significantly. Professional movers use specialized equipment like hydraulic dollies, lift gates, padded blankets, and anchoring straps to ensure the item stays exactly where it should during each phase of the move.

Foxborough itself can add some layers to the equation. Located midway between Boston and Providence, the area offers a blend of older Colonial-style homes and newer developments. Some homes feature narrow hallways or steep cellar stairs—obstacles that make gun safe relocation even more nuanced. It's not just about brute strength; it's about coordination, measurement, and problem-solving. That’s the difference between amateur attempts and professional results.

Weather plays a role too. Whether it’s humid summers or icy winters, the New England climate influences how and when a move should be scheduled. Moisture-sensitive flooring, slippery sidewalks, or frost heaves in driveways can create hazards if not carefully managed. Experienced movers in this region know how to plan around these variables, selecting the right day, timing, and equipment based on conditions that less experienced crews might overlook.

Now, if you’re wondering what to expect when you schedule a gun safe move, transparency is key. You should receive an initial walk-through or consultation, during which movers assess the safe’s size, weight, and current location. They'll plan the best route out of the home and into the moving truck, avoiding potential damage points like sharp corners or soft floors. On moving day, expect a well-coordinated team with the right tools, clear communication, and protective gear to shield your property from harm.

A good mover will also discuss placement at your destination. Will it go into a basement? A second-floor room? A garage? The final placement often poses as many challenges as the initial removal. Elevation changes, structural weight limits, or restricted access all come into play. Your movers should walk you through each concern, offering options rather than presenting problems.
